原文:淺談JS的數組遍歷方法

用過Underscore的朋友都知道,它對數組 集合 的遍歷有着非常完善的API可以調用的, .each 就是其中一個。下面就是一個簡單的例子: 上面的代碼會依次輸出 , , , , ,是不是很有意思,遍歷一個數組連for循環都不用自己寫了。 .each 方法遍歷數組非常好用,但是它的內部實現一點都不難。下面就一起來看看到底是如何實現 .each 的。在這之前,我們先來看看 .each 的API ...

2016-06-14 17:03 0 9924 推薦指數:

查看詳情

淺談6種JS數組遍歷方法的區別

  本篇文章給大家介紹一下6種JS數組遍歷方法:for、foreach、for in、for of、. each、 ().each的區別。有一定的參考價值,有需要的朋友可以參考一下,希望對大家有所幫助。 一、for   Javascript中的for循環,它用來遍歷數組 ...

Wed May 20 01:01:00 CST 2020 0 730
js數組遍歷方法總結

1.for循環 使用臨時變量,將長度緩存起來,避免重復獲取數組長度,當數組較大時優化效果才會比較明顯。 2.foreach循環 遍歷數組中的每一項,沒有返回值,對原數組沒有影響,不支持IE 3.map循環 有返回值,可以return出來 map的回調函數中支 ...

Tue Dec 04 23:01:00 CST 2018 0 1624
JS數組遍歷方法集合

就讓我們在逆戰中成長吧,加油武漢,加油自己 1.for循環 使用零時變量將長度存起來,當數組較大時優化效果才會比較明顯。 2.foreach循環 遍歷數組中每個數,沒有返回值 使用break不能中斷循環,使用return也不能返回到外層函數 ...

Mon Feb 24 02:27:00 CST 2020 0 1565
js數組遍歷方法總結

js數組遍歷方法總結 數組遍歷方法 1.for循環 使用臨時變量,將長度緩存起來,避免重復獲取數組長度,當數組較大時優化效果才會比較明顯。 1 2 ...

Mon Nov 22 18:15:00 CST 2021 0 827
js數組遍歷方法總結

數組遍歷方法 1.for循環 使用臨時變量,將長度緩存起來,避免重復獲取數組長度,當數組較大時優化效果才會比較明顯。 for(j = 0,len=arr.length; j < len; j++) { } 2.foreach循環 遍歷數組中的每一項 ...

Fri Jul 13 22:09:00 CST 2018 0 175847
js遍歷數組的幾種方法

js遍歷數組,基本就是for ,for in,foreach,for of, map等方法。 第一種:for for(var i=0;arr.length;i++){ console.log(arr[i]) } 第二種:foreach循環 arr.forEach ...

Wed Apr 29 06:13:00 CST 2020 0 1366
JS數組與對象的遍歷方法大全

本文簡單解析各種數組和對象屬性的遍歷方法: 原生for循環、for-in及forEach ES6 for-of方法遍歷數組集合 Object.key()返回鍵名的集合 jQuery的$.each ...

Sun Jun 14 17:58:00 CST 2020 0 768
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M